I am currently planning a low budget, small form factor build that includes the fractal design node 202. I don't have the budget to buy high capacity SSDs so i am stuck with 3.5" HDDs that I already own. The only real problem I am having with this build is the fact that the node 202 does not natively support 3.5" drives. I would like to use a mITX gpu and mount the hdd to the spare fan mount but i am unaware of any 120mm to 3.5" adapters.

Does anyone have any experience with this case or ideas on how i could pull this off?
